WebThese materials are melted together at 1,500 to 1,700 degrees Celsius and then the molten material is chilled to cool. The product, when cooled, is ground and screened to certain particle sizes that forms the granular flux for welding. WebThey are: 1) In the weld metal during or immediately after welding. 2) In the base metal near a weld joint. Microfissures can develop in the as-deposited weld metal shortly after solidification, or they can occur in the heat-affected zones of previously deposited (sound) beads of weld metal. Webwhere welding in this area is unavoidable. The issue with the k-area is that when a wide flange is rotary straightened at the mill, the k-area of the web undergoes cold working and loses some ductility as a result. When you place residual stresses in the area (resulting from weld cooling and restraint) there is a possibility that a crack can form.
